Stability tests should also consider the particular matrix where the molecule will be used. Notably, batch-to-batch structural uniformity ensures reliable long-term stability. Best peptide facial serum displays a favorable combination of chemical stability and membrane permeability in standard assays. Stability against thermal denaturation can be enhanced through backbone N-methylation strategies. Best peptide facial serum exhibits favorable stability characteristics, maintaining structural integrity under moderate storage conditions. Hydrolysis of peptide bonds occurs more rapidly at elevated temperatures and extreme pH values. Thus, stability and permeability together influence the effective concentration of a molecule at its site of action.

The lamellar structure of the stratum corneum is most stable when ceramide, cholesterol, and fatty acid ratios are maintained at 1:1:0.5, as validated by X-ray diffraction. Ceramide and cholesterol compounding rebuilds complete lamellar lipid arrays on damaged skin surfaces. Given their amphipathic properties, ceramides blend naturally with aqueous formula systems. A 1:1:1 molar ratio of ceramide, cholesterol, and fatty acid is the minimal requirement for forming a functional lamellar barrier in vitro. Best peptide facial serum and ceramides act through complementary mechanisms to support epidermal homeostasis. Lipid structure scanning shows ceramide blends restore 87.0% of damaged lamellar barrier architecture in vitro. Therefore, the integration of ceramides into peptide formulations supports both delivery and barrier function.
